June 26th marks a special day! Also known as 6/26, it’s the day we honor our favorite Experiment 626 Stitch from Disney’s Lilo & Stitch! To celebrate this lovable animated alien, Disney World has special Stitch merch and snacks available now! Speaking of snacks, we tried these 626 Day-exclusive snacks and we have a ton of thoughts!

Taking place all over Disney World, 626 Day has special food offerings all over Disney World — and we tried it all!

Up first, we tried the Lilo and Stitch Slushy at Amorette’s Patisserie in Disney Springs.

Lilo & Stitch Slushy

This POG slushy (passion fruit, orange, and guava) costs $6.50 and is made with frozen Minute Maid, passion fruit, orange, and guava juice and topped with whipped cream and a Lilo and Stitch chocolate décor.

This was essentially the same pog slushy we tried The Mara in Animal Kingdom, which is a good thing!  This drink is a bit more orange-forward! The drink is fairly sweet, so keep that in mind before purchasing. We also preferred the whipped cream by itself, as we thought it didn’t mesh great with the citrus. The white chocolate was also forgettable and not a strong addition to the drink.

Still, we quite liked this and found it to be a worthy ode to Lilo & Stitch!

The drink is very good, but we could do without the chocolate

Next up, we tried the Experiment 626 Cone at Pineapple Lanai at Disney’s Polynesian Village Resort. This blue vanilla soft-serve cone with cotton candy flavors topped with Stitch ears chocolate décor costs $5.79.

Experiment 626 Cone

This June 26th-exclusive dessert has a nice vanilla and light cotton candy blend that’s not overly sweet. It’s a return hit and we can definitely see why!

The white chocolate ears give a nice crunch texture and we think this ice cream cone works really well overall, but be sure to eat it quickly — it melts fast!

Finally, the last snack we tried was the Experiment 626 Éclair at Amorette’s Patisserie in Disney Springs. Another POG dessert, the Experiment 626 Éclair is made with passion fruit and mango.

Experiment 626 Éclair

This éclair is available now through June 30th for $7.25. 

We LOVED this dessert! The fruit flavor was never overpowering and the tangy aftertaste of the passion fruit was truly amazing. The cream is the star here and the soft nature of this dessert makes it refreshing on a warm day!

This dessert is a winner!

You can also pick up the Stitch Blueberry-Lemonade Mousse Cake at Cosmic Ray’s Starlight Café in Magic Kingdom on June 26th! This 626 Day dessert is made with Blueberry mousse, lemon curd, vanilla cake, and mango glaze.
